Flask In the Storm, Male Tabaxi [Permalink]
Personal [hide]
Description: He is in excellent shape and wears a simple pastel robe with white stripes complete with hood. His yellow fur is kept up in a ponytail inside a Stetson hat. His face is feral with sharp distinguishing features. His spectacle hidden eyes are a deep amber.
Personality: He is inclined to make off color jokes and interpret anything that could be construed as such as innuendo. He is skeptical of what others tell him and is slow to trust.
History: Raised by wardens he was only a novice when goblins swooped upon their monastery and killed most of the order. His father was supposedly a charlatan fortune teller, but he insists his father was legitimate. Days after completing his studies, news broke out that his hometown was attacked by goblins. Flask was horrified and prayed that his father was alright. However, he heard that his father had died fighting off the goblins.
Motivation: His religion dominates his actions.
Ideals: Athletic, Joker. Flaws: Shy. Bonds: Religious, Enemies. Occupation: Adventurer
Voice: Italian accent

Pallabar Maekkelferce, Male Gnome [Permalink]
Personal [hide]
Description: He is a pot bellied eastern man with a big hulking figure and broad shoulders. He wears a blue collared shirt and black pants. He accessorizes with a grey scarf around the waist and a strap diagonally across his shirt. His moppish chestnut hair is in a traditional bowl cut. His violet unseeing eyes seem to look past you.
Personality: He believes mankind has become decadent and spoiled by the march of civilization and an end should come to life as we know it. He enjoys reading and quiet.
History: Trained by his father for as long as he can remember he had it drilled in his head that it was his duty to serve his country. Cursed with lycanthropy at a very young age, Pallabar has worked very hard to control his curse. He hopes to save up enough money to one day pay a cleric to cure him.
Motivation: To share knowledge with the world; and wants to work out more often
Ideals: Athletic, Logical. Flaws: Disease. Bonds: Nature, Military. Occupation: Beggar
Voice: Shortens vowels

Beloril Bigtoe, Male Dwarf [Permalink]
Personal [hide]
Description: This malnourished man is wearing a long, grey, dusty cloak. He has done his best to style his white hair to look like a famous performer. His eyes are likewise amber.
Personality: He likes to fabricate stories about his past exploits and how crazy he is, but in actuality he is rather bland. He receives visions of the future at random moments
History: The child of a Bricklayer, who enjoyed hunting, Beloril was taken on many hunting expeditions. Ostracized due to the necromantic powers of his oldest sister, he and his siblings struck out on their own. In the process these unassuming Dwarves became a terror of the countryside. He's also a talented Bricklayer, but doesn't like to broadcast it.
Motivation: A strong sense of loyalty to Half-Orc people; and sabotage a competitor
Ideals: Gifted. Flaws: Mundane, Racist. Bonds: Poor, Nature, Job. Occupation: Tanner
Voice: Hissing voice

Harann Vangdondalor, Female Dragonborn [Permalink]
Personal [hide]
Description: A woman with a calm yet intense air about her, she wears light armors faded through time and improper care. She keeps her copper crest in a pixie cut. Her eyes, though not visible through her cowl, are gold.
Personality: She misses her glory days as an athlete. She does not mind her job, but it is boring in comparison. The war was a terrible time for her, and Harann does not often speak of it. When she does, she does so with a strained expression and tears in her eyes.
History: She was born the only child of a wealthy merchant. Her father was a soldier and died while she was still young. Harann was left her father's suit of armor and trained in its use and care. She has been a successful dealer in antiques buying low and selling high.
Motivation: Retire the richest woman in the south; and she loathes her own lifestyle
Ideals: Athletic, Entrepeneur. Flaws: Depressed. Bonds: Military. Occupation: Healer
Voice: Nasally tone
